8.—(1) The company shall designate a person who shall be responsible for monitoring the safe and efficient operation of each ship with particular regard to the safety and pollution prevention aspects.
(2) In particular, the designated person shall—
(a)take such steps as are necessary to ensure compliance with the company safety management system on the basis of which the Document of Compliance was issued; and
(b)ensure that proper provision is made for each ship to be so manned, equipped and maintained that it is fit to operate in accordance with the safety management system and with statutory requirements.
(3) The company shall ensure that the designated person—
(a)is provided with sufficient authority and resources; and
(b)has appropriate knowledge and sufficient experience of the operation of ships at sea and in port,
to enable him to comply with paragraphs (1) and (2) above.
